This is the 318th most frequent Japanese word.
卵
Egg.
Here, 卵 refers to eggs as a food ingredient, commonly used for cooking and eating.
朝ごはんに卵を食べます。
I eat eggs for breakfast.
In this sentence, 卵 is metaphorically used to describe someone as being in the 'budding' stage of developing a skill or profession.
彼はまだ科学者の卵だ。
He is still a budding scientist.
